[Alpha Biz= Kim Jisun] SK Group is partnering with Amazon Web Services (AWS) to construct a large-scale, AI-dedicated data center in the Mipo National Industrial Complex in Ulsan, South Korea.
According to industry sources on June 15, the two companies plan to hold a launch ceremony for the "SK-AWS Data Center" within the month, followed by a groundbreaking ceremony in August. The facility will be built on a 36,000-square-meter site in Hwangseong-dong, Nam-gu, Ulsan. Phase one is scheduled to go online by November 2027 with a capacity of approximately 40 megawatts (MW), expanding to a total of 100MW by February 2029.
This marks Korea’s first AI infrastructure to feature a dedicated 100MW-scale GPU-based system, expected to house around 60,000 graphics processing units (GPUs).
SK Group will mobilize its core affiliates—such as SK Telecom and SK Broadband—to build an integrated AI platform that combines cloud technology with manufacturing capabilities. The Ulsan Mipo site was chosen for its robust power supply infrastructure and strategic location near SK Gas’s power plant, which is expected to create significant synergy.
The nearby SK Gas facility is the world’s first gigawatt-scale combined cycle power plant capable of using both LNG and LPG. The site’s ability to utilize LNG cold energy for data center cooling adds further operational advantages.
